Trino, ehemals bekannt als PrestoSQL, ist eine offene Quellcode-Datenintegration- und -Analyseplattform für relationalen Datenbankabfragen sowie für Semistructurierte (NoSQL) und Maschinelles Lernalphabetisches Dateisysteme. Trinos Ziele sind die Einführung einer effizienten, skalierbaren und einheitlichen Plattform für das Analysieren von verschiedenen Datenquellen im Unternehmenseinsatz sowie in der Forschung.
Überblick
Trino basiert auf einer verteilten Architektur und ist vollständig in Java implementiert. Die wichtigsten Funktionen umfassen den Abruf von Daten aus verschiedenen Quellen, die Verarbeitung dieser Daten im Hintergrund und das Bereitstellen der Ergebnisse für Abfragen und Berichte über ein Webinterface oder eine API.
Wie die Konzeption funktioniert
Trino Trinos Funktionsweise kann in drei Hauptkomponenten eingeteilt werden:
- Datenquellen : Trino ermöglicht den Zugriff auf Daten aus einer Vielzahl von Quellen, darunter relationalen Datenbankmanagementsysteme (RDBMS), Semistructurierte NoSQL-Systeme und Maschinelles Lernalphabetisches Dateisysteme.
- Datenverarbeitung : Die eingehenden Abfragen werden parallel verarbeitet. Dies geschieht in Hintergrundprozessen, sodass Benutzer die Ergebnisse ihrer Abfragen schnell erhalten können.
- Ergebnisisseingabe : Trino stellt die Ergebnisse der Abfrage bereit, entweder als einfache Tabellenansichten oder auch komplexere Visualisierungen.
Typen und Variationen
Es gibt verschiedene Arten von Datenintegration- und -Analyseplattformen auf dem Markt. Einige dieser Plattformen sind:
- Verteilte relationalen Datenbanksysteme : Diese bieten eine hohe Skalierbarkeit, aber oft erfordern sie spezifische Abfragesprachen.
- Semistructurierte NoSQL-Systeme : Sie unterstützen flexible Datenschemata und sind besonders für große Mengen an ungeordneter Daten geeignet.
- Datenintegration-Plattformen : Diese können sich auf den direkten Abruf von Daten aus verschiedenen Quellen konzentrieren, was eine wesentliche Eigenschaft der Trino Plattform ist.
Rechtlicher Kontext und regionale Einwirkungen
Die Verwendung von Trino kann je nach regionaler Rechtslage variieren. So kann beispielsweise das Datenschutzrecht wichtige Implikation für die Durchführung einer Datenanalyse mit Hilfe der Anwendungsplattform haben.
Demo- oder nicht-monetäre Modelle
Für interessierte Entwickler und Testfälle bietet Trino eine Möglichkeit, auf eine Demo-Umgebung zuzugreifen. Diese ermöglicht den direkten Zugriff zu einer Beispielumgebung mit minimalen Anpassungen an der Software.
Real Money vs Free Play Unterschiede
Die Verwendung von Trino für reale Geldabfragen ist nicht in seiner ursprünglichen Konzeption vorgesehen, sondern es handelt sich um eine Analyse- und Testplattform. Differenzen zu Anwendungen mit nicht-monetären Modellen beruhen auf den spezifischen Anforderungen an die Sicherheit des Betreibs in einer real money Umgebung.
Vorteile und Einschränkungen
Ein Vorteil von Trino ist die einfache Einbindung in vorhandene Datenbanksysteme. Dadurch können Unternehmen ihre bestehenden Systemlandschaften schnell mit der Fähigkeit zur Datenanalyse ausstatten, ohne sich einer kompletten Umstellung auf neue Lösungsangebote unterwerfen zu müssen.
Einer Einschränkung von Trino ist die Komplexität bei groß angelegten Abfragen. Sie erfordern oft eine hohe Menge an Ressourcen, und der Betrieb kann dann schwierig werden.
Gemeinsame Missverständnisse oder Mythen
Zu den häufigsten Fehldarstellungen von Trino gehören Ansichten über die Komplexität des Systems sowie mögliche Probleme mit Skalierung. Diese können in manchen Anwendungsfällen zutreffend sein, sind aber in der Regel kein genereller Bestandteil ihrer Funktionsweise.
Benutzererfahrung und Zugänglichkeit
Trino ist über die Befehlszeile oder eine grafische Oberfläche erreichbar. Daher kann Trino sowohl von erfahrenen Nutzern als auch von Anwendungsfeinmeistern genutzt werden, ohne sich zu sehr mit komplexeren Programmiersprachen beschäftigen zu müssen.
Risiken und Verantwortungsbewusstsein
In der Analyse großer Datenmengen sollte das Datenschutzgesetz beachtet werden. Deshalb wird empfohlen, alle gesammelten Daten vorab zu anonymisieren, um vertrauliche Informationen zu schützen.
Zusammenfassende Analyse und Bewertung
Trino ist eine fortschrittliche Anwendungsplattform für die Integration und Analyse großer Datensätze. Sie erfüllt sich der Komplexität des Datenmanagements durch verteilte Architektur und parallelisierung von Prozessen, was ihr als Skalierbarkeitsergebnis eine breit gefächerte Unterstützung in den Unternehmen zu seiner Fähigkeit zur Integration verschiedener Quellen innerhalb von großen Datenbanken.
Das Verständnis der zugrunde liegenden Architektur und Funktionsweise ermöglicht es Unternehmen, Trinos Vorteile voll auszunutzen.
Comentarios recientes